Formula
hectomoles = femtomoles × 1e-17
This factor comes from each unit's defined relationship to the category's base unit: 1 femtomole equals 1e-15 base units, and 1 hectomole equals 100 base units, so dividing one by the other gives the direct femtomole-to-hectomole factor of 1e-17.
